#include
int isprime(int n)
{
int i;
for(i = 2; i < n ;i++)
if(n%i == 0)
break;
if(i == n)
return 1;
else
return 0;
}
int main(void)
{
int n,t;
int s = 0;
scanf("%d",&n);
t = n;
while(t!=0)
{
s = s+t%10;
t = t/10;
}
if(isprime(s)&&isprime(n))
printf("%d是完美素数\n",n);
else
printf("%d不是完美素数\n",n);
return 0;
}